Default Aquarium brace/frame replacement question

The tank I purchased has a melted centre brace, the top fram needs to be replaced.

Suggestions on who to go through for ordering a new top frame for a 90g 48x18?

Talk to concept aquariums in Calgary. If anyone can help u with tank parts I'd say it'd be them. The other option is you could pull off the remaining trim around the top and just eurobrace the top of the tank yourself. Just get some pieces of glass cut and silicone them. Then put the trim back on or buy new trim

You could epoxy a piece of clear acrylic in it's place or replace the whole top frame with euro bracing. If you really want to replace it a LFS should be able to order one in or look at the classifieds for a scratched up 90g that someone is giving away for dirt cheap.
